N.M. Admin. Code § 13.19.4.28 - ENFORCEMENT
A.
Enforcement action for failure to comply with rule. The
superintendent may revoke, suspend or refuse to continue the registration of a
MEWA that fails to comply with this rule and may impose such other applicable
administrative penalties authorized under the Insurance Code.
B.
Cease and desist. When the
superintendent believes that a MEWA or any other person is operating in this
state without a registration or has violated the law or a rule or order of the
superintendent, the superintendent may issue an order to cease and desist such
violation or take any other action set forth in Section
59A-16-27 NMSA 1978.
C.
Penalty. Any person or entity
who violates any provision of this rule is subject to the penalties provided in
Section 59A-1-18 NMSA 1978.
